WebAug 9, 2024 · In CuSO 4.5H 2 O, water acts as ligand as a result it causes crystal field splitting. Hence d—d transition is possible in CuSO 4.5H 2 O and shows colour. In the anhydrous CuSO 4 due to the absence of water (ligand), crystal field splitting is not possible and hence no colour.

It loses two water molecules upon heating at 63 °C (145 °F), followed by two more at 109 °C (228 °F) and the final water molecule at 200 °C (392 °F). The chemistry of aqueous copper sulfate is simply that of copper aquo complex, since the sulfate is not bound to copper in such solutions.
